    U.S. Surgeon General Dr. Vivek Murthy: Efforts & Challenges in Promoting Public Health

    U.S. Surgeon General Dr. Vivek Murthy: Efforts & Challenges in Promoting Public Health

    Huberman Lab

    In this episode, my guest is Dr. Vivek Murthy, M.D., the acting U.S. Surgeon General who earned his undergraduate degree from Harvard and his M.D. from Yale School of Medicine. We discuss nutrition, food additives, social media and mental health, public health initiatives to combat the crisis of social isolation, the obesity crisis, addiction and other pressing issues in public health. Dr. Murthy explains the role of the U.S. government in promoting specific public health issues and the steps needed to rebuild public trust in scientific and medical information. We also discuss health care accessibility, insurance barriers and individual versus team-based medical care.
